Few Issues After Update
Nonetheless, post One UI 8 Watch updates, some few users are still reportedly experiencing unknown performance problems after XI things.
Reportedly, for the Galaxy Watch 4 Classic users, this includes heavy battery draining, crashing of some apps all the time, and their watch becoming unresponsive. They say that certain functions worked perfectly for some days before failing after the update. Other people suspect these bugs are a result of an arguably glitchy firmware implementation on the watch. When the problem raised its head, Samsung was pretty quick in bringing out the patches; thus, making it much easier for the users to get the needed fixes.
